Samsung Galaxy S10e 128GB
The Samsung Galaxy S10e is the smallest of the just-released S10 series, but it is still a huge performer, as you'd expect from a phone pitched at the upper end of the market.
An awesome display
This device wows at first sight, with its 5.8-inch all-screen Infinity-O display. The Dynamic AMOLED screen technology reduces blue light without compromising picture quality. The result is one of the clearest and most vivid displays of any smartphone brand.
A genius camera set up
Samsung cameras have set the standard in recent times and the S10e is no excpetion. It consists of a 16MP ultra-wide + 12MP wide angle lens on the back, plus a 10MP front camera. Features include the Ultra Wide Camera which takes cinematic photos with a field of vision beyond what the human eye can see. No matter what sort of photo you want to take, the intelligent camera takes stunning photos by automatically optimising your camera settings to the scene.
Video magic
You can create awesome moving pictures as well with video features that include 4K UHD video recording at 60 fps and dramatic Super Slow-mo.
Samsung's super sound
Samsung have made a point of creating sensational audio in their S Series phones. As a result, the S10e delivers ultra-high quality audio playback and surround sound with Dolby Atmos technology, which is mind-blowing for gamers, movie watchers or music lovers.
Designed to perform
The S10e keeps humming in fine style with a Exynos 9820 processor, and a minimum of 6GB RAM and 128GB of built-in memory, with a 512GB expansion slot. The 3100mAh battery, and wireless charging, give you extended use during the day and fast, effortless charging when you need it.
